My approach to therapy

I specialize in complex mental health and comorbidity – when it’s not just one issue, but several interacting at once. This can include emotional intensity, anxiety, ADHD, psychosis, trauma, thought disturbances, anger, severe mental illness, substance abuse, or just long-standing patterns that feel impossible to shift. I know how to untangle what feels overwhelming and help you move forward with confidence.

My style is solution-focused, down-to-earth, creative, and collaborative. You won’t find clinical jargon or a one-size-fits-all approach with me; instead, you’ll find an experienced guide who sees you as a whole person with strengths worth building on. No judgment. Just honest conversations, steady support, and practical tools that create real-life change.
